THIS film is based on the true story of daredevil pilot Barry Seal (Cruise, who looks nothing like the real-life character), who leaves his job as a commercial pilot for a more exciting life with the CIA.

The story begins in the late 1970s, and goes right on into the late 80s. It all starts when Seal, who is bored with his mundane life, is approached by a mysterious man called Schafer (Gleeson), who knows all about Seal helping to smuggle contraband for Cuban exiles in the US.

Schafer offers Seal a job flying a private plane for the CIA under the radar of South American countries with communist leanings, and taking aerial photograph­s of certain

‘sensitive’ sites.

Meanwhile, his wife Lucy (Wright) thinks her husband works for an airline.

Seal risks his life and even gets shot at for his efforts, but isn’t paid all that well by the CIA.

Now that he has children, Seal readily agrees to help smuggle drugs into the US for the Medellin cartel who pays him very handsomely.

However, Seal finds his problems only beginning, as both his employers start demanding more and more out of him. Things really begin to hit home when Lucy’s troublesom­e brother J.B. (Caleb Landry Jones) finds out what Seal does, and starts taking the hidden cash for himself.

The movie is more comical than dramatic, but to be fair, the crazy situations that Seal constantly keeps finding himself in are really over-thetop.

Look out for Jayma Mays (who was last seen as the meek germphobic guidance counsellor in Glee) playing an overzealou­s Attorney General who tries to prosecute Seal.

But she finds her efforts thwarted by politician­s who are determined to cover up Seal’s government­sanctioned activities.

All in, this is an interestin­g movie about one of the many disastrous US-backed involvemen­ts in foreign soil, and how ordinary people end up paying dearly for it.
